The Evolution of Energy Storage: From Lithium-Ion to Semi-Solid State Innovation
To understand the significance of the Renogy Pro S1 Series, it’s important to trace how energy storage has evolved. Traditional lithium-ion batteries have powered countless devices for decades, but they come with limitations — primarily safety concerns, electrolyte leakage, and shorter lifespan when subjected to high stress. In contrast, LiFePO4 batteries introduced a more stable and safer chemistry, providing consistent performance with minimal risk of overheating or combustion.
Now, the world is turning toward solid-state and semi-solid state batteries, which use solid or gel-like electrolytes to enhance safety and energy density. However, these technologies have often been limited to research labs and high-end prototypes due to their cost and production complexity. Why LiFePO4 Still Sets the Standard for Safe, Reliable Power
Even as the industry moves toward solid-state designs, LiFePO4 (Lithium Iron Phosphate) chemistry remains a gold standard for reliability and safety. Its naturally stable composition minimizes risks like overheating and fire, making it ideal for residential and mobile applications. Compared to traditional lithium-ion cells, LiFePO4 batteries deliver more consistent voltage, longer cycle life, and better tolerance to full discharges. This stability means users can confidently rely on them for powering essential appliances, solar panels, and energy storage systems.
